Kwara Coding Programme Advances Hands-On Digital Learning in Week Three

Date: 2026-08-25

The 2026 Summer Edition of the Kwara Coding and Digital Literacy Programme continued in its third week, with learners across participating centres receiving practical training in programming, web development and data analysis.

Participants underwent intensive Python programming sessions covering conditional statements, loops, lists, tuples, sets, dictionaries and functions. The lessons were designed to strengthen their logical reasoning, problem-solving abilities and capacity to develop structured and efficient programs.

Learners also advanced their knowledge of JavaScript through lessons on variables, data types, logical operations and conditional statements.

In web development, participants worked on personal portfolios and HTML forms while gaining practical experience with CSS positioning, Flexbox, media queries and JavaScript interactivity. The programme also strengthened participants' data-analysis skills through Microsoft Excel lessons covering data validation and PivotTable analysis.

Some learners were introduced to Python tools and libraries, including SQLite3, Tkinter and Bcrypt, to broaden their understanding of practical software development.
